Back in my day druids would take dragonshape and become untouchable gods.
The Nomad was INSIDE the city gates, and outside them was the farmlands, bramble and SUNITE CARAVAN PARK <3
Surfacers and Underdarkers were autohostile and going too close to enemy settlements would trigger a killscript that just kills your character.
Death penalty was a few days worth of XP.
Circle grinding frost giants above Brog was your life from level 18 until 30.
Don't level too fast, or let a DM catch you running instead of walking (even if you are the ONLY PLAYER ONLINE), or they will dock XP/levels (ouch, found out the hard way a few times).
You had to apply for a PrC token for Weapon Master, and when denied because of above mentioned running, too bad. Embrace life as a pure vanilla NWN fighter (no modern perks).
All characters could take THREE major gifts, and one of them was +32 SPELL RESISTANCE. I wonder if some of these are still around.
There were characters who were actual dragons, with wings, tails, claws, horns and permanent true seeing/spell resistance.
You would actually get put in (and left in) jail when arrested in Cordor. Occasionally guard players would come to check on you and RP with you. It was really, really awesome and I miss it.
There was a whole settlement just for paladins and goody-two-shoes types.
Anyone could roll up Weavemasters. They're like sorcerers but all spells are infinite spells. I always kick myself for not rolling one up just to keep in my vault.

Back in my day, you had to use a gift slot to take your subrace traits. (After gifts were added. I remember before gifts)
Udos Dro'xun got hit by an event which destroyed bridges and you had to go through lowbie dungeons to get to some parts of the city. Also accessing the Temple had a weird climb check that no cleric could make b/c climb was tied to martial classes innately.
Favored Soul was a weird bard-esque subtype class that could raise the dead with the radial menu. If you had PM levels you could death touch with one hand and raise touch on the other, heh.
Heavy armor slowed you down, oof.
Auto-hostile between UD and Surface. Interesting coordination to turn off the hostile before an errant summon made things violent if you wanted a non-killy encounter.
No writs or Adventure XP drip.
V A N I L L A NWN appearances. Thank heavens for NWN Sync.
